About

E.R. Taylor is a scholar working on Ceramics and Composites, Electrical and Electronic Engineering and Atomic and Molecular Physics, and Optics. According to data from OpenAlex, E.R. Taylor has authored 47 papers receiving a total of 671 indexed citations (citations by other indexed papers that have themselves been cited), including 33 papers in Ceramics and Composites, 32 papers in Electrical and Electronic Engineering and 19 papers in Atomic and Molecular Physics, and Optics. Recurrent topics in E.R. Taylor’s work include Glass properties and applications (32 papers), Solid State Laser Technologies (19 papers) and Photonic Crystal and Fiber Optics (15 papers). E.R. Taylor is often cited by papers focused on Glass properties and applications (32 papers), Solid State Laser Technologies (19 papers) and Photonic Crystal and Fiber Optics (15 papers). E.R. Taylor collaborates with scholars based in United Kingdom, Italy and Poland. E.R. Taylor's co-authors include L.N. Ng, D.N. Payne, Kazimierz Jędrzejewski, Neil P. Sessions, P.R. Morkel, Gilberto Brambilla, А. Палеари, N. Chiodini, J. A. Medeiros Neto and Johan Nilsson and has published in prestigious journals such as Applied Physics Letters, Journal of Applied Physics and Optics Letters.
